Analysis
Vanuatu recorded -0.8771 % change on previous year for all crops — burning crop residues (biomass burned, dry matter) in 2023.
That represents a change of down 119.9% on the previous year and down 112.3% over ten years.
Over the whole period, all crops — burning crop residues (biomass burned, dry matter) in Vanuatu peaked at 10 % change on previous year in 1975 and was at its lowest, -3.78 % change on previous year, in 2012.
That places Vanuatu 112th out of 201 countries with data for 2023, putting it in the middle of the range.
The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.

How this figure is calculated
The year-on-year percentage change in All Crops — Burning crop residues (Biomass burned, dry matter). Computed from consecutive annual observations; years either side of a gap are skipped rather than bridged.
Computed from
- All Crops — Burning crop residues Food and Agriculture Organization of the United Nations
Statizoid computes this series; the underlying measurements belong to the publishers named above. The arithmetic is applied to every country and year where both inputs report, and nothing is estimated unless the page says so.
